Las Vegas Area Short Sale Homes For Sale

The absorption rate for Las Vegas Valley Area Short Sales is finally seeing movement.  Absorption is moving to the stable market territory at only 6.5 months of inventory.  Solds have FINALLY gone from hovering the 200 unit mark and went over the 500 mark.  I see improvement in this sector! Inventory has decreased  (-116 units).  Pending units have increased by +179 units.    Solds have increased by +96 units. 

There are many reasons for the lack of closings in this market and it is outlined in this post

Short Sale Synopsis:

  • Listings 11/15/2009: 4475
  • Pending 11/15/2009: 8738
  • Closed October 2009: 688
  • Month's Inventory: 6.5

Short Sales Currently Account for:

  • 43% of All Las Vegas Valley Listings
  • 16% of All Las Vegas Valley Sales
